Complement component C7 is an integral part of the membrane attack complex (MAC), a crucial effector in the innate and adaptive immune responses. The MAC plays a pivotal role by forming pores in the plasma membrane of target cells, leading to cell lysis and destruction. C7 functions as a membrane anchor in this process, and it can exist as a monomer or dimer, with the potential to form multimeric rosettes when part of the C5b-7 complex. MAC assembly begins with the proteolytic cleavage of C5 into C5a and C5b, and subsequently, C5b binds sequentially to C6, C7, C8, and multiple copies of the pore-forming subunit C9. This orchestrated sequence highlights the essential role of C7 in the assembly of MAC, contributing to the immune system's ability to eliminate target cells.
